Automotive Key Replacement: The Comprehensive Guide
Losing or harming an automotive key can be a discouraging and typically pricey experience. As keys have actually become more technically advanced, so too have the approaches for their replacement. In this article, we will explore the process of automotive key replacement, the various kinds of keys, the associated expenses, and what customers must consider when they discover themselves in need of a new key.

Comprehending Automotive Keys
Automotive keys have actually evolved significantly over the years, transitioning from easy metal designs to detailed electronic devices. Below are the main types of automotive keys currently in usage:
Type of Key | Description |
---|---|
Traditional Key | A standard metal key that runs the ignition and locks. |
Transponder key fob replacements | Consists of a chip that communicates with the vehicle's ignition system to prevent theft. |
Smart Key/ Key Fob | Provides keyless entry and ignition, typically geared up with functions like remote start and panic buttons. |
Laser-Cut Key | A key with an unique style cut utilizing a laser for boosted security, needing special equipment for duplication. |
1. Standard Key
The traditional key is the most basic form of automotive key. It runs mechanical locks and ignition systems and can be easily duplicated at a local locksmith or hardware store.
2. Transponder Key
Presented in the 1990s, transponder keys have actually a chip embedded in them that sends a signal to the vehicle's security system. If the signal is not acknowledged, the vehicle will not start, discouraging theft. Replacement usually includes reprogramming the vehicle's onboard computer.
3. Smart Key/ Key Fob
Smart keys or key fobs have become increasingly popular in modern-day cars. They provide convenience by permitting drivers to unlock and begin their cars without physically placing a auto key fob replacement. However, their complexity makes them more costly to replace.
4. Laser-Cut Key
Laser-cut keys have a more detailed style that needs specialized cutting devices, making them harder to replicate. They supply an increased level of security, however this also results in greater replacement costs.
The Key Replacement Process
The procedure of replacing an automotive key can vary based on the type of key and the make and design of the vehicle. Normally, the following actions are included:
Step 1: Identify the Type of Key
Before starting the replacement process, it's crucial to identify the kind of key needed. This can usually be identified by consulting the vehicle's handbook or getting in touch with the producer.
Action 2: Gather Required Documentation
Many key replacement services require specific documents to make sure the vehicle owner's identity and ownership of the vehicle. This generally includes:
- Proof of ownership (vehicle title or registration)
- Driver's license
- Vehicle identification number (VIN)
Step 3: Choose a Replacement Method
Depending on the complexity of the key, customers have numerous choices for replacement:
- Local Locksmith: For standard or transponder keys, a local locksmith can typically supply replacement car key service services, especially for older automobiles.
- Dealership: Visiting a dealer is a reliable but typically more expensive option for acquiring smart keys or laser-cut keys, as they have direct access to the maker's requirements.
- Online Services: Online key replacement services provide a more affordable option however may include longer wait times for shipping.
Step 4: Programming the New Key
When it comes to transponder keys and clever keys, programming is essential to make sure compatibility with the vehicle's ignition system. This procedure may differ by vehicle make and model and is often carried out by a locksmith or dealer.
Step 5: Test the Key
When the replacement is acquired and configured, testing the type in numerous locks and ignition systems is vital to ensure performance.
Cost of Automotive Key Replacement
The cost of changing an automotive key can substantially vary based on the key type and the approach of replacement. The following table lays out the typical expenses related to different types of keys:
Key Type | Estimated Cost Range | Extra Notes |
---|---|---|
Conventional Key | ₤ 1 - ₤ 10 | Easy to duplicate at many hardware shops. |
Transponder Key | ₤ 50 - ₤ 150 | Requires programming; may need to check out a locksmith. |
Smart Key/ Key Fob | ₤ 100 - ₤ 400 | Pricey; usually only offered through dealerships. |
Laser-Cut Key | ₤ 150 - ₤ 300 | Specialized devices required for duplication. |
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. For how long does it take to replace a lost car key?
The time can differ based on the kind of key and where you get it replaced. Traditional keys can be replaced in simply a few minutes, while smart keys may take numerous hours due to programs requirements.
2. Can I replace my car key myself?
While it's possible to get a blank key and suffice yourself for conventional keys, the majority of contemporary keys, especially transponder and clever keys, need specific equipment and shows that generally just a locksmith or car lost key replacement dealership can supply.
3. What should I do if I lose my only key?
If you lose your only key, calling a locksmith or your car dealership is recommended. They can often develop a new key from the vehicle's VIN number or special codes.
4. Are there any preventive procedures to prevent losing car keys?
- Key Finders: Utilize Bluetooth key finder gadgets that can help you find your keys from your smart device.
- Designated Spot: Always keep your keys in a designated location in the house.
- Spare Key: Have a spare key replacement key made and keep it in a safe location.
